    The way you used the insta360 mount caught my attention...I usually use it upside down compared to you and attach my bike computer on top of it, which I hate. I'm going to try your way and see if it works better for me! Also, I used that mount on my mountain bike (bad idea) and all of the bouncing caused the carbon rod to strip and break on the end that attaches to the mount. I was able to super glue it back together but it would be nice if Insta sold those rods separately. I probably should've noticed that they recommend NOT using it on a mountain bike. 🙂 Thanks for the video!

    Good vid. X3 User here. My experiance is that the attachment points will fail. I had my x3 hit the deck twice, both times the lens were saved by the clear lens guards. 1st time the moto mount failed, the thread end snapped, 2nd time the threads on the selfie stick wore out. Keep an eye on attachment point wear. Out front won't work with aero bars either. Otherwise i enjoy the x3.
